What Feng Shui Is and Isn'tFeng Shui isn't something you do, it's something you already have, good or bad. Good Feng Shui is all about balance and harmony. It’s all about what makes you feel happy, safe and secure. Bad Feng Shui makes you feel sad, vulnerable and insecure. Good or bad, Feng Shui is all about you!
